GB/T 24174-2022 NATIONAL STANDARD OF THE PEOPLE’S REPUBLIC OF CHINA ICS 77.040.10 CCS H 22 Replacing GB/T 24174-2009 Steel - Determination of Bake-Hardening-Index (BH) ISSUED ON: APRIL 15, 2022 IMPLEMENTED ON: NOVEMBER 01, 2022 Issued by: State Administration for Market Regulation; Standardization Administration of the People's Republic of China. Table of Contents Foreword ... 3 1 Scope ... 5 2 Normative references ... 5 3 Terms and definitions ... 5 4 Symbols and descriptions ... 5 5 Principle ... 6 6 Test equipment ... 7 7 Specimens ... 7 8 Test methods ... 7 9 Calculation of test results ... 9 10 Test report ... 13 Steel - Determination of Bake-Hardening-Index (BH) 1 Scope This Standard specifies the principle, test equipment, specimens, test methods, calculation of test results and test reports for the determination of the Bake-Hardening- Index (BH) of steel. This Standard applies to the determination of the Bake-Hardening-Index of steels with bake hardening phenomena. NOTE: This Standard is mainly used in the automotive industry. 2 Normative references The following referenced documents are indispensable for the application of this document. For dated references, only the edition cited applies. For undated references, the latest edition of the referenced document (including any amendments) applies. GB/T 228.1-2021, Metallic materials - Tensile testing - Part 1: Method of test at room temperature GB/T 8170, Rules of rounding off for numerical values and expression and judgement of limiting values 3 Terms and definitions For the purposes of this document, the terms and definitions defined in GB/T 228.1- 2021 as well as the followings apply. 3.1 Bake-Hardening-Index; BH The increase in yield strength of the specimens pre-stretched with or without the specified amount of strain after baking at 170°C for 20min relative to the yield strength of the same or another specimen in the original state. 4 Symbols and descriptions The symbols given in Table 1 apply to this document. 6 Test equipment 6.1 The accuracy requirements of the tensile testing machine and extensometer are in accordance with the provisions of GB/T 228.1-2021. 6.2 The temperature control accuracy of the heating device is ±2°C. The resolution of the temperature measuring device shall not exceed 1°C. 7 Specimens The specimen shall use the P5, P6 and P17 lead specimens in Annex B of GB/T 228.1- 2021. When the product standard or contract does not specify the specimen type number, the P17 specimen shall be used. 8 Test methods 8.1 Test classification According to the number of specimens used in the test, the test methods are divided into two categories. a) Use a specimen to determine. According to the difference of determination methods, it is divided into BH2, BH2H, BH2L and BH2P. When the product standard or contract does not stipulate, BH2 shall be used. b) Use two specimens to determine. Use BH0 to express. 8.2 Test conditions 8.2.1 Test temperature Unless otherwise specified, the test shall be carried out at room temperature within the range of 10℃ ~ 35℃. For tests with strict temperature requirements, the test temperature shall be 23°C ± 5°C. 8.2.2 Tensile test rate 8.2.2.1 To better maintain the consistency of test results, a uniform tensile test rate shall be used. 8.2.2.2 When measuring Rt2.0, Rp2.0, Rp0.2, Rp0.2,t, ReL and ReL,t, it is recommended to set the test rate according to the beam displacement rate of 5%Lc per minute. When measuring ReH,t, it is recommended to set the test rate according to the beam displacement rate of 2.5% Lc per minute. The test rate shall not be switched from the start of the stretch to the measurement of the above indicators. 8.2.3 Baking treatment 8.2.3.1 After the temperature of the heating device reaches 170°C, put the specimen to be baked. After the temperature of the heating device reaches 170°C again, keep the temperature for (20.0±0.5) min. Take out the specimen immediately. Place in air to cool to room temperature. 8.2.3.2 During baking, the specimens shall not be stacked. They shall be placed separately on the shelf. 8.2.3.3 The same tensile testing machine shall be used for the two tensile tests before and after baking. 8.3 Determination methods 8.3.1 Determination of BH2 Use a tensile test specimen. According to the provisions of GB/T 228.1-2021, the specimen is first subjected to pre-strain stretching with a total strain of 2.0%. Obtain Rt2.0. After the pre-tensile specimen is subjected to the prescribed baking treatment, the tensile test is performed on the sample again. Obtain ReL,t or Rp0.2,t (when there is no apparent yield). 8.3.2 Determination of BH2H Use a tensile test specimen. In accordance with the provisions of GB/T 228.1-2021, the specimen is first subjected to pre-strain stretching with a total strain of 2.0%. Obtain Rt2.0. After the pre-tensile specimen is subjected to the prescribed baking treatment, the tensile test is performed on the specimen again. Obtain ReH,t or Rp0.2,t (when there is no apparent yield). 8.3.3 Determination of BH2L Use a tensile test specimen. According to the provisions of GB/T 228.1-2021, the specimen is first subjected to pre-strain stretching with a total strain of 2.0%. Obtain Rp0.2. After the pre-tensile specimen is subjected to the prescribed baking treatment, the tensile test is performed on the specimen again. Obtain ReL,t or Rp0.2,t (when there is no apparent yield). 8.3.4 Determination of BH2P Use a tensile test specimen. According to the provisions of GB/T 228.1-2021, the specimen is first subjected to pre-strain stretching with a total strain of 2.2%. Obtain Rp2.0. After the pre-tensile specimen is subjected to the prescribed baking treatment, the tensile test is performed on the specimen again. Obtain ReL,t or Rp0.2,t (when there is no apparent yield). Steel bake hardening value (BH2) measurement method 1 Scope This standard specifies the value of bake hardening steel (BH2) terms and definitions, principle, test equipment, samples, test procedures, test report. This standard is applicable to the bake hardening steel. Note. This standard is mainly used in the automotive industry. 2 Normative references The following documents contain provisions which, through reference in this standard and become the standard terms. For dated references, subsequent Amendments (not including errata content) or revisions do not apply to this standard, however, encourage the parties to the agreement are based on research Whether the latest versions of these documents. For undated reference documents, the latest versions apply to this standard. GB/T 228 metal materials at room temperature tensile test method (GB/T 228-2002, eqvISO 6892.1998) GB/T 8170 repair value expressed about the rules and limit values \u200b\u200band judgment 3 Terms and Definitions GB/T 228 as well as established the following terms and definitions apply to this standard. 3.1 BH2 Bake hardening values \u200b\u200b(the BH2) is pre-stretched 2.0% total strain in a sample at a temperature of 170 ℃ bake yield strength after 20min (ReL, t) with respect to the original state of the sample yield strength (Rt2.0) value added. 2.0% of the total pre-stretched to simulate stamping strain should Changing, and 170 ℃ baking 20min to simulate baking after painting. 4 Symbols and Symbols used in this standard and are described in Table 1. Table 1 Symbols and Symbol Unit Description Specimens Rt2.0 MPa stress to total strain of 2.0% Rp0.2, t MPa sample was 2.0% strain and after baking, the corresponding plastic strain of 0.2% when stress (when no significant yield) ReL, t MPa sample was 2.0% and after baking under strain measured yield strength BH2 MPa bake hardening value Principle 5 Increase the strength of the sample after the heat treatment of 2.0% of pre-deformation and a predetermined yield determined bake hardening value. 6 Test Equipment Tensile testing machine in accordance with the requirements of GB/T 228 requirements. 7 samples The specimen shall comply with GB/T 228's. ......
